Extractive metallurgy - Wikipedia

Extractive metallurgy is a branch of metallurgical engineering wherein process and methods of extraction of metals from their natural mineral deposits are studied. The field is a materials science, covering all aspects of the types of ore, washing, concentration, separation, chemical processes and extraction of pure metal and their alloying to suit various applications,

nickel processing - Extraction and refining | Britannica

Extraction and refining. The extraction of nickel from ore follows much the same route as copper, and indeed, in a number of cases, similar processes and equipment are used. The major differences in equipment are the use of higher-temperature refractories and the increased cooling required to accommodate the higher operating temperatures in nickel production.

Silver Mining and Refining | Education

If an ore contains gold and silver, it is treated with a solution of sodium cyanide to dissolve both metals. When powdered zinc is added to the solution, the precious metals form a sludge, which is collected and further refined to separate the gold from the silver. Gold Smelting & Refining Process

Feb 28, 2016· The fluxes to be used must be chosen with detail in order to avoid wrong results. The sample preparation is other problem since these materials contains free gold. A good recipe has the following composition, 30 g litharge, 30 g sodium carbonate, 25 g borax, 5 g flour, 8 g fluorspar, 30 g silica and 20 g ore sample.

Jewelry Metals 101: Gold, Silver, and Platinum,

Once refining became possible, artisans used platinum to decorate porcelain while scientists made laboratory equipment from it. However, refining platinum with arsenic proved extremely dangerous. Thus, platinum didn’t gain much popularity until the invention of the oxyhydrogen torch in the mid-1800s.
